We’re acting for a London-based firm, famous for their work assisting clients embroiled in administrative or regulatory processes with an international, political, or diplomatic context. Some of the highest profile work in this category involves representing individuals and entities who are the subject of asset freezing measures, or ‘targeted sanctions’. The firm has advised many clients who have challenged such sanctions measures before a range of tribunals including the High Court in London, the General Court and the ECJ in Luxembourg as well as before the United Nations Office of the Ombudsperson in New York.
The firm’s client base consists of high profile individuals, businesses, and sovereign states, and they have a reputation for robustly defending their clients’ positions in the media and the Courts.
